Figure 5. Actual level of hydration VS predicted level of hydration by the BiLSTM. Hydration status can be monitored in several ways by both athletes as well as health and performance staff members.

While laboratory-based testing using blood or urine samples is considered to be of higher quality, they have traditionally been the most difficult to implement in a team setting.

Because of this many athletes and teams opt to use easier testing methods, despite limitations of accuracy or reliability. These methods include subjective urine color charts, weigh-ins and sweat rate, and relative thirst levels. PROS: can be intertwined with pre- and post-activity weigh-ins and provides insight into total body water volume. This can be done on a near daily basis and performed throughout the day as well.

CONS: the equipment can be very expensive and require dedicated space and access that can be difficult to accommodate.

Bio-Impedance also possesses a relatively high error variance for assessing total body water, even when adhering to strict protocols. As many athletes and staff know, it can be quite difficult to adhere to strict measurement protocols in a busy team setting.
